Unveiling the Historical Treasures of Casa Grande
Casa Grande's story is deeply intertwined with its fascinating past. The city's namesake, the Casa Grande Ruins National Monument, is a testament to the ingenuity and artistry of the ancestral Sonoran Desert people. Imagine standing before a four-story structure, built by the Hohokam people centuries ago! This impressive structure, constructed between 1300 and 1450 AD, served various purposes, including astronomical observations and community gatherings. What's even more mind-blowing is that the Hohokam people built this without metal tools, using only the resources they had around them. Talk about impressive! When you visit the monument, you can walk through the ruins, explore the museum, and learn about the Hohokam way of life, including their sophisticated irrigation systems that allowed them to thrive in the harsh desert environment. The Visitor Center provides invaluable insights, showcasing artifacts and exhibits that bring the history to life. The site also includes walking trails, providing opportunities to get a closer look at the surrounding desert landscape and appreciate the perseverance of the people who once called this place home. Exploring the Casa Grande Ruins is like stepping back in time, and it offers a chance to connect with a culture that has profoundly shaped the region.

Planning Your Trip to Casa Grande
Alright, you're probably getting excited and starting to think about how to plan your trip to this Arizona oasis! Planning your trip to Casa Grande is simple. Let's cover some basic things.
First, deciding when to go is important. The best time to visit Casa Grande is during the fall, winter, or spring months when the weather is mild and pleasant. Summers in the desert can be scorching hot, so it's best to avoid visiting during that time unless you're prepared for the heat. Remember to pack accordingly and stay hydrated. You may want to bring sunscreen, hats, and light clothing during the day and be prepared for cooler evenings. You should also consider booking accommodations in advance, especially during peak season or if you plan to visit during a special event. Casa Grande offers various accommodation options, from cozy hotels and motels to vacation rentals and RV parks.
Next, consider how you'll get around. The best way to explore Casa Grande and its surroundings is by car, which gives you the freedom to explore at your own pace. If you're flying into Arizona, you can rent a car at the airport. Otherwise, ridesharing services like Uber and Lyft are available for getting around town.
